Features and Benefits

  • Superior Materials of Construction: Precision investment cast 316 stainless steel liquid end components for corrosion resistance and strength.
  • Frame Mounted Design: Flexibility of installation and driver arrangements.
  • Enclosed Impeller Design: Maximum efficiency and service life with no need for clearance adjustment. Key driven shaft connection with locknut.
  • Back Pull-Out Design: Simplifies maintenance by allowing the casing to remain in the piping during disassembly.
  • Close-Coupled Design: Compact design saves space and simplifies installation.
  • Casing Features: Investment cast AISI type 316 stainless steel, volute design for maximum efficiency. Vertical discharge standard, field modifiable to four standard positions.
  • Shaft and Sleeve: High strength steel, keyed design non-wetted. Protected from pumpage by O-ring seal and hooked design AISI type 316 stainless steel shaft sleeve.
  • Mechanical Seals: Standard Flowserve Type 31 seal with carbon versus Silicon-Carbide faces, Viton elastomers and 316 stainless steel metal components. Options are available for high temperature and mild abrasives.
  • Drive Motors: NEMA standard JM frame (close coupled) or T frame (frame mounted) are available in both single and three phase with a variety of enclosures and voltages to match your service requirements.

Applications

  • Pure water feed or transfer
  • Chemical feed or transfer
  • Pharmaceutical services
  • Food or beverage services, not requiring FDA rating
  • Condensate return
  • Water reclamation and treatment
  • Washer equipment and scrubbers
